Per previous, I loath the “silence is assent” model of decision making that’s common in civil society networks but I am also exceptionally overloaded at the moment so can’t keep sending reminders and waiting for replies, and things have to move.  I’ve proposed that we fund Robin’s travel to Singapore (she’s kindly offered to help lead on some conference logistics) and that we also fund one night of hotel for any NCUC members who can arrive early and help with/attend the conference.  We have the money to cover this and nobody’s objected, so I’m going to assume that’s ok so Robin can make her arrangements and Milton can come prepared to handle the hotel payments.  We can formally ratify this post hoc at our EC meeting in Singapore on Saturday.

Please remember that we have an Event Team conference call today at 3pm CET to plan the conference agenda, which desperately needs to get posted and advertised even if some bits are still TBD.  It’d be great to have as many EC members involved as possible.

> As I’ve mentioned before, NCUC does have money in an account that it can use to fund travel of folks—whether elected EC, appointees, or just regular members who are really involved in something—who need to attend a particular meeting.  In general we’ve been pretty conservative in managing these resources; last year, I think we only paid once, for an EC member to attend Durban.  Since I was able to convince ICANN to fund another EC traveler for Singapore, I would think we should be able to handle Robin’s request without worry.
